October 29 is the set date for the last installment of the Saw franchise, the Saw 3D. Lionsgate is pulling out all the stops in the viral marketing department to promote the hell out of Jigsaw’s swan song.
The viral marketing onslaught begins with BobbyDagen.com, the blog of Jigsaw victim Bobby Dagen (played by Young Indiana Jones himself, Sean Patrick Flanery). He survived one of Jigsaw’s (Tobin Bell) tests and has since written a book about his experiences. He’s also speaking out about it via Facebook, and Twitter. There’s also a site for The Survivors of Jigsaw, which will introduce new survivors there weekly.
Fans can also take the “Challenge” over at the official Saw Facebook page for a chance to win free tickets to Saw 3D — or an actual trap from the film!
Finally, Lionsgate, Twisted Pictures and RealD have teamed for the nationwide “Saw Fan Appreciation Night” on Thursday, October 28. Participating theaters will be offering limited edition Saw 3D glasses (which have “I SAW IT FIRST 10.28.10” on them) for those purchasing admission to 8pm, 10pm, and midnight shows on the 28th. Tickets to Saw Fan Appreciation Night are now available for purchase at Fandango.com.
